
Merlot Bosc is from the best location and area of the vineyard named Bosc. Harvest is late and carried out on the full ripeness of the grapes. Wine is produced by the process of maceration lasting for 12 days and it is aged in oak barrels (barriques) for 22 months. Merlot Bosc fragrance is reminiscent of dried plums, ripe and cooked forest fruits, jam and herbs. At tasting this wine is rich and complex with ripe tannins and a long aftertaste that reminds us of ripe red fruit. It is great accompaniment to mature cheeses, red meat and wild game meat.
